jczechjr, hopefully you read the specs on your failsafe. For some reason, Futaba failsafes ONLY work with NiCD batts, NOT alkaline or NiMH batts! Supposedly there's something to do with the discharge rate on them. Anyway, I am placing an order in a few weeks for a Duratrax Mini Quake and a whole bunch of goodies and included in that order will be a Duratrax failsafe, which will work like a charm. The Venom and OFNA failsafes might be okay too, but their comments don't specify.

This is copied directly from the comments section of the Futaba fail safe on Tower Hobbies:
COMMENTS: For use with NiCd batteries only, no alkalines or Manganese dry
cells.
The discharge curve of alkalines and NiMH cells is different from
that of the NiCd cells for which this unit was designed. Non-NiCd
cells will not provide the warning at the appropriate time.
Does not work with transmitter in PCM mode.

This one is straight from the Futaba receiver with built in fail safe:
COMMENTS: The R143F receiver cannot be used with dry cell or NiMH batteries.
These batteries cannot endure a large current draw and the voltage
will drop frequently even though the battery is new

Here's the Duratrax Fail Safe - http://www2.towerhobbies.com/cgi-bin...&I=LXHLV3&P=ML

This comment is included in the specs:
REQUIRES: Use of NiCD or NiMH batteries, do NOT use ALKALINES
Connecting between receiver and throttle servo
